Senator Bukola Saraki, representing Kwara Central at the National Assembly made this known while addressing reporters in Ilorin, the Kwara State, Friday. Saraki who noted that he once used his position as the chairman Nigeria Governors’ Forum to settle a similar situation in 2011. According to Saraki: “Because of the selfish interest of President Goodluck Jonathan in seeking re-election, he cannot look at the governors and tell them point blank what he wants. What I disagree with is that because the issue pertains to PDP, it is being made very important. “You say the governors are emperors, the system gives those powers to the governors. It is something that should have been addressed, because some of us saw it coming.” “The crisis between the state governors of the PDP and their Senators is an internal affair of their party and it shouldn’t have been allowed to affect running of the upper chamber of the National Assembly. “I sympathise with my colleagues from the PDP because of where they find themselves.
